What does this checker review?

This checker reviews whether randomly connecting strangers or deliberately hiding user identity is a core app function, whether minors are blocked where required, and whether important child safety standards, reporting mechanisms, contacts, and Play Console declarations appear to be in place.

Why this matters for Google Play

Apps with anonymous or random chat functionality can face specific Google Play requirements related to age restrictions, child safety, reporting, and policy declarations. Missing requirements may create review, rejection, or availability risk.
